Twitter is awesome.

Why?

Because of the following 8 reasons:

Reason 1: Makes you improve your writing

The 140 character limit forces you to master the art of getting to the point.

Reason 2: When bad/good news breaks you find out first

Global disasters, terrorist attacks, hero pilots making crash landings on the hudson river are revealed first on twitter. While the rest of the media is cranking out articles, twitter people are banging out scoop in 140 characters or less with links to leaked video, images and other relevant media.

Reason 3: Find interesting people

Got that latest weird Lady GaGa single stuck in your head? Type the name of the song into the search field and you will find countless people with the same problem.

Reason 4: Find Freelancers

Using advanced google searches to search the twittersphere you can find people who list specific occupations in their twitter bio … Explained in detail at “How To Find Specific Types Of Twitter Users” …

Reason 5: Get more exposure to blog posts

Thanks to services like TwitterFeed you can hookup your RSS feeds to your twitter account so as soon as you publish your latest blog post BOOM! A link to it is posted direct to your twitter feed without you needing to lift a finger.
